none
Как удалить почтовый ящик учётки из дочернего домена? RRS feed

  • Вопрос

  • Приветствую!

    Есть умерший дочерний домен (закрылся филиал и всё оборудование выключили), в котором учётные записи пользователей имели почтовый адреса в родительском домена. Сейчас, при попытке удалить ящик, Exchange пытается найти контроллер дочернего домена и не может. Соответственно ящик не удаляется. Нельзя даже посмотреть его свойства.

    Как же его всё-таки выгрузить и грохнуть?

    4 февраля 2013 г. 9:15

Ответы

Все ответы

  • Этот умерший домен в том же лесе? Если да, то надо предварительно вычистить AD от мусора - потерянных DCs.


    Сазонов Илья http://isazonov.wordpress.com/

    • Помечено в качестве ответа Yuriy Lenchenkov 13 февраля 2013 г. 13:41
    4 февраля 2013 г. 9:28
    Модератор
  • Пример удаления.

    Active Directory – Remove a Domain Using NTDSUTIL

    Бекап наше все.


    MCITP. Знание - не уменьшает нашей глупости.

    4 февраля 2013 г. 10:54
    Модератор
  • NTDSUtil я уже пробовал - эта утилита не отображает нужный сайт для выбора, так как он отмечен как удалённый (посмотрел через ADExplorer). Соответственно, я не могу и сервер выбрать, не выбрав сайт. Тем не менее, Exchange по-прежнему пытается достучаться до дочернего КД BELSRV01. Как ему объяснить, что стучаться некуда?

    5 февраля 2013 г. 8:09
  • см. картинку:


    5 февраля 2013 г. 8:25
  • Проверьте, что метаданные были очищены и прошла репликация.

    Статьи.

    Удаление потерянных доменов из Active Directory

    Clean up server metadata


    MCITP. Знание - не уменьшает нашей глупости.

    5 февраля 2013 г. 11:32
    Модератор
  • Все эти операции я уже попробовал.

    Чтобы удалить домен - нужно сначала удалить все его контроллеры домена.

    Чтобы выбрать КД - нужно сначала выбрать сайт с ним.

    Сайт в списке сайтов не отображается - поэтому его нельзя выбрать.

    metadata cleanup: remo sel dom
    DsRemoveDsDomainW error 0x2162(The requested domain could not be deleted because  there exist domain controllers that still host this domain.)
    metadata cleanup: remo sel dom
    Operation cancelled

    5 февраля 2013 г. 11:50
  • Ok. С ошибкой проще.

    Unable to remove child domain


    MCITP. Знание - не уменьшает нашей глупости.

    • Помечено в качестве ответа Yuriy Lenchenkov 13 февраля 2013 г. 13:41
    5 февраля 2013 г. 13:06
    Модератор
  • Ok. С ошибкой проще.

    Unable to remove child domain


    MCITP. Знание - не уменьшает нашей глупости.

    Выполнил указанные рекомендации в ссылке (tombStoneLifetime = 2, garbageCollPeriod = 1) - умерший домен пропал. Но только Exchange на это никак не прореагировал. При попытке удаления ящика появляется всё то же сообщение, что КД в дочернем домене не найден. Он по-прежнему в него верит!

    13 февраля 2013 г. 13:49
  • Могу только еще раз указать ссылку на читку домена (. 

    delete a no more existing domain from a survivng forest

    http://support.microsoft.com/kb/230306

    http://social.technet.microsoft.com/Forums/en-US/winserverDS/thread/f92b489a-2d4c-48c7-bd4e-811ed9327030


    MCITP. Знание - не уменьшает нашей глупости.

    13 февраля 2013 г. 14:17
    Модератор
  • AD от мёртвого домена очищена. Но мне всё-таки не понятно, каким образом это должно объяснить Exchange, что теперь не нужно пытаться удалить ящик из несуществующего домена? Почтовик до сих пор обращается к тому, чего нет. Где хранится привязка ящика в домену?
    15 февраля 2013 г. 5:22
  • Помимо чистки AD, надо удалить записи из DNS.

    Exchange вычитывает конфигурацию из AD. После удаления subdomain, ящики пользователей помечаются как удаленные.


    MCITP. Знание - не уменьшает нашей глупости.

    15 февраля 2013 г. 6:26
    Модератор
  • Удалить записи из DNS конечно несложно, но Exchange просто не сможет разрешить имя КД в дочернем домене и опять выдаст ошибку о том, что КД не доступен.
    Поиск ящиков, которые нужно удалить, в АД по атрибуту mail результата не дали - их нет. Но тем не менее Exchange всё равно из видит и отображает в консоли.

    15 февраля 2013 г. 8:18
  • Попробуйте

    Get-MailboxDatabase | Clean-MailboxDatabase 

    Потом надо будет подождать (сутки хватит :-) ) и перезапустить консоль.


    Сазонов Илья

    https://isazonov.wordpress.com/

    12 марта 2016 г. 13:30
    Модератор